Navigating the Increasing Complexity

Initially, the challenge in a typical chicken crossing game, like a chicken road casino variation, involves dodging a relatively sparse stream of vehicles. The cars move at a predictable pace, allowing players to easily learn the timing required to safely guide their feathered friend across the road. However, this initial tranquility is short-lived. As the player progresses, the game begins to introduce new elements designed to increase the difficulty. This might involve an increase in the speed of the vehicles, the introduction of more lanes of traffic, or the addition of obstacles such as trucks, buses, or even motorcycles, each possessing unique movement patterns.

The strategic shift required to adapt to these changes is where the game's true challenge lies. Players can no longer rely on memorizing simple patterns; they must react dynamically to the ever-changing conditions. They need to learn to anticipate the movements of different types of vehicles and adjust their timing accordingly. Sometimes, the best strategy involves patience, waiting for a clear opening in the traffic. Other times, a quick, decisive dash is the only way to survive. One compelling mechanic frequently appears – the ability to collect power-ups that briefly grant invincibility or slow down time, offering a strategic edge in particularly challenging situations. The skillful use of these power-ups can be the difference between success and a feathery demise.

Understanding Traffic Patterns and Optimal Timing

Successfully traversing the road isn’t just about luck; it’s about understanding the underlying rhythm of the traffic flow. Observing the gaps between vehicles and predicting their trajectories are crucial skills. Pay attention to the speed of approaching cars, as faster vehicles will require more precise timing. Look for patterns – do certain lanes tend to be more congested than others? Are there specific times when traffic momentarily slows down? The ability to identify and exploit these patterns is what separates casual players from true masters of the chicken crossing art. Practice makes perfect; the more time spent playing, the more instinctively these patterns will become apparent.

Furthermore, understanding the limitations of the chicken’s movement is key. There's typically a slight delay between input and action, so players must anticipate this lag and adjust their timing accordingly. Rushing a move often leads to disaster, while waiting too long can result in being clipped by an oncoming vehicle. There's a delicate balance between boldness and caution, a feeling that defines the addictive nature of the game. The ability to react quickly and accurately under pressure is the defining characteristic of a skilled player.

Traffic Type Movement Pattern Difficulty Level
Cars Consistent speed, predictable trajectory Easy
Trucks Slower speed, wider profile, less maneuverable Medium
Motorcycles High speed, erratic movements Hard
Buses Slow acceleration and deceleration, large size Medium-Hard

The table above illustrates how different vehicle types demand nuanced strategies for successful navigation. Mastering these distinctions is vital for progressing through the levels.

The Psychology Behind the Addictiveness

The simple yet challenging gameplay of these games taps into several psychological principles that contribute to their addictiveness. The intermittent reward schedule, where rewards are given out at unpredictable intervals, is a powerful motivator. The unpredictability creates a sense of anticipation and excitement, encouraging players to continue playing in the hope of receiving the next reward. This is the same principle that drives many other forms of gambling, and underscores the "casino" aspect of the genre’s name.

Furthermore, the game provides a constant stream of immediate feedback. Each successful crossing is instantly rewarded with points or coins, providing a sense of accomplishment and reinforcing the player’s behavior. The game’s difficulty curve is also carefully designed to keep players engaged without becoming overly frustrated. The challenges are gradually increased, pushing players to improve their skills without overwhelming them. This balance between challenge and reward is crucial for maintaining player motivation. The very act of attempting to conquer the increasing difficulty taps into the human desire for mastery.

The Role of Dopamine and Flow State

The constant cycle of challenge and reward triggers the release of dopamine in the brain, a neurotransmitter associated with pleasure and motivation. This dopamine rush creates a positive feedback loop, reinforcing the desire to continue playing. Furthermore, the intense focus and concentration required to successfully navigate the road can induce a state of "flow," where players become completely absorbed in the task at hand and lose track of time. This immersive experience is highly enjoyable and contributes to the game’s addictiveness.

It's a surprisingly deep psychological experience hidden within a seemingly simple game. The blend of skill, timing, and reward is carefully calibrated to maximize player engagement and keep them returning for more.
